(3) Vascular Tissues: Vascular tissue includes blood, lymph and the structures in which these fluids are formed, stored and destroyed. These are connective and support tissues that have no other purpose except to fill the body. i) This tissue consists of star-shaped reticular cells whose protoplasmic process joins to form a cellular network.ii)The reticular cells consist of reticular fibres made up of reticulin protein.iii)This tissue is found in the liver, spleen, lymph nodes, thymus, tonsils, bone marrow and lamina propria of the gut wall.Function: This tissue provides strength and support to many organs. It is of further two types, i.e., white fibrous connective tissue (includes tendons and sheets) and yellow elastic connective tissue (includes ligaments and sheets).Functions: The tendons join the skeletal muscles with the bones, and the ligaments join bones to bones.
